Output 27c850317da2722931c032951a89c019f5a37a656b4112634efae3015b067582:0

value
1532726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ec6cb575c86b6976c85eefd05e446e54d6c809e OP_EQUAL
address
3AL9b3dAXBBZJrZ2vEZu5PYo5BxKhpcquG
transaction
27c850317da2722931c032951a89c019f5a37a656b4112634efae3015b067582
spent
true